ServiceNow is seeking a Senior Lifecycle & Email Marketing Strategist to own lifecycle email strategy and deployment for high-complexity, high-visibility programs across Integrated Marketing buying group programs (IT, CRM, Employee Experience, Risk & Security).
In this role, you will define and execute comprehensive lifecycle email strategies covering audience segmentation, campaign architecture, content point of view, volume and cadence planning, and KPIs. You'll partner with Integrated Marketing counterparts, Campaign Managers, Audience Planners, and Content Strategists to align strategy across multiple dimensions.
Key responsibilities include:
- Own lifecycle and email campaign architecture across email nurtures, webinar promotion, event invitations, and product launches
- Manage strategy and deployment for high-complexity or high-visibility programs mapped to buying group structures and ABX motion
- Define audience segmentation by buying group roles, account tier, and lifecycle stage
- Partner with Content Strategists to shape email content journey and persona-level messaging
- Set volume and cadence plans with quarterly targets, audience cuts, and fatigue governance
- Define KPIs and activities by campaign type tied to program business outcomes
- Build, configure, and deploy email programs end-to-end in Marketo Engage or comparable platforms, including branching logic, dynamic content, and template architecture
- Refine lifecycle copy frameworks and use AI-assisted tooling to scale persona-level content across Champions, Economic Buyers, and Influencers
- Operate human-in-the-loop approval gates on agentic builds and contribute to governance standards refinement
- Design A/B and multivariate testing programs, surface insights through QBR reporting, and address sequencing conflicts and governance risks
Requirements:
- 6+ years in B2B email marketing, lifecycle marketing, or marketing automation with hands-on experience deploying programs in enterprise marketing automation platforms and operationalizing lifecycle strategy
- Hands-on experience deploying email programs in Marketo Engage required; Adobe Journey Optimizer B2B, Salesforce Marketing Cloud, or Oracle Eloqua acceptable
- Deep expertise in audience selection, triggered sends, dynamic content, branching logic, and template architecture
- Multi-stage lifecycle program design experience across Awareness, Education, Acquisition, Progression, and Adoption stages, including Flagship event programs and multi-product motions
- Ability to design audience segmentation and cadence architecture for high-complexity programs with volume targets, audience cuts, and fatigue rules
- Strong narrative and copy skills with fluency in persona-level messaging and content strategy
- A/B and multivariate testing experience tied to business impact with ability to define KPIs by campaign type
- Analytical fluency to partner with Analytics and Digital teams on KPI scoping and performance reporting
- Practical experience with lifecycle copy frameworks, AI-assisted copy and personalization tooling, and human-in-the-loop approval gates
- Compliance knowledge: CAN-SPAM, CASL, GDPR, CCPA/CPRA
- Cross-functional influence and ability to operate as email channel voice in planning forums
- Strategic definition skills for ambiguous or high-complexity scope
- Systems thinking to understand how email decisions ripple across cadence, sender reputation, and buying group engagement
- Operational discipline to manage multiple high-stakes programs on overlapping timelines
- Automation mindset with judgment on where AI improves program quality
Preferred qualifications:
- Track record applying ABM, ABX, or buying group frameworks to email strategy
- Fluency with Adobe Experience Platform and Real-Time CDP
- Familiarity with webinar and event platforms (ON24, RainFocus) and their integration into lifecycle programs
- Track record using AI tools to improve email throughput, personalization, or decision quality
